u/Illustrious_Pea_3470 3d ago

This just isn’t true. There’s no way to take a benzo dose daily that doesn’t make you physically dependent on it. Per the black box warning added by the FDA a few years ago: “Physical dependence can occur when benzodiazepines are taken steadily for several days to weeks, even as prescribed. Stopping them abruptly or reducing the dosage too quickly can result in withdrawal reactions, including seizures, which can be life-threatening.”
